Fred VanVleet Out Indefinitely: Houston Rockets Star Suffers ACL Tear
Houston Rockets’ star point guard Fred VanVleet is set to miss an extended period, possibly the entire 2025-26 season, after suffering a torn ACL (Anterior Cruciate Ligament). This devastating blow was confirmed by sources who spoke with ESPN on Monday.
VanVleet, a one-time NBA All-Star and former NBA champion with the Toronto Raptors, joined the Rockets in 2023. In just two seasons, he transformed the franchise from a lottery team to a playoff contender, guiding them to 52 wins and the Western Conference’s No. 2 seed last season.
Prior to the injury, VanVleet had signed a two-year, $50 million extension with Houston, which includes a player option for the 2026-27 season.
Despite posting career-highs in fewest points per game (14.1) in the regular season, VanVleet stepped up in the playoffs, averaging 18.7 points per game. Known for his tenacious defense and playmaking, VanVleet was a key cog in the Rockets’ offense, finishing second on the team in 3-point attempts per game (7.7) last season.
Rumors have circulated about potential trades and signings to bolster the Rockets’ roster in VanVleet’s absence.
